When comparing the Honda CB500F 2021 and the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022, there are several key differences to consider.

In terms of engine power, the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 takes the lead with 68.2 HP compared to the Honda CB500F 2021's 48 HP. The Kawasaki also has a higher torque of 65.7 Nm compared to the Honda's 43 Nm. This means that the Kawasaki offers more power and acceleration, making it potentially more thrilling to ride.

Both bikes have a similar engine configuration, with 2 cylinders and liquid cooling. This ensures efficient performance and prevents overheating during long rides.

In terms of chassis, both bikes have a steel frame, which provides stability and durability.

When it comes to braking, the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 has an advantage with double disk brakes at the front, compared to the Honda CB500F 2021's single disk. Both bikes have double piston brakes, ensuring reliable and responsive braking power.

In terms of dimensions and weights, both bikes have the same front and rear tire width and diameter, ensuring good grip and stability on the road. They also have the same wheelbase of 1410 mm, providing a balanced and maneuverable ride. However, the seat height is slightly higher on the Kawasaki at 820 mm compared to the Honda's 790 mm. This may be a consideration for riders with shorter legs.

In terms of weight, the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 is slightly lighter at 187.1 kg compared to the Honda CB500F 2021's 194 kg. This can contribute to easier handling and maneuverability, especially in tight corners or during low-speed maneuvers.

Both bikes have a fuel tank capacity of around 15 liters, providing a decent range for long rides without frequent refueling.

Moving on to the strengths of each bike, the Honda CB500F 2021 boasts a full 48 hp in the A2 class, making it a suitable choice for riders with an A2 license. It also has a high-quality fork, ensuring a smooth and comfortable ride. The brakes on the Honda are also good, providing reliable stopping power. The seating position is comfortable, and the low seat height makes it accessible for riders of all heights. The Honda CB500F 2021 also offers intuitive handling, making it easy to maneuver in various riding conditions.

On the other hand, the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 stands out with its perfectly realized retro design, which is sure to turn heads on the road. It features analogue displays, adding to its classic appeal. The engine on the Kawasaki is lively and responsive, providing an exhilarating riding experience. The handling is accessible, making it suitable for riders of different skill levels. The brakes are powerful, ensuring quick and reliable stopping. The ergonomics of the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 are comfortable, allowing for long rides without discomfort. Additionally, the levers on the Kawasaki are adjustable, allowing riders to customize their riding position for optimal comfort.

In terms of weaknesses, the Honda CB500F 2021 has been noted to have a suspension strut that bounces on bumpy roads. This may affect the overall ride quality and comfort. On the other hand, the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 has a slightly softer sound, which may be a consideration for riders who prefer a more aggressive and sporty exhaust note.

Overall, both the Honda CB500F 2021 and the Kawasaki Z650 RS 2022 have their own unique strengths and weaknesses. The Honda offers a suitable option for riders with an A2 license, with its full 48 hp in the A2 class. It also provides a comfortable and intuitive riding experience. On the other hand, the Kawasaki stands out with its retro design, lively engine, and comfortable ergonomics. Ultimately, the choice between the two will depend on the rider's preferences and priorities.

Honda has significantly improved the rounded package called CB500F for 2022. Thanks to better brakes and a higher-quality chassis, the handling has been significantly upgraded. Both beginners and experienced riders will feel very comfortable on this bike and enjoy it for many years to come. Only the suspension strut is not quite up to scratch - but there still needs to be room for improvement somewhere.

With the RS, Kawasaki proves that it has mastered the art of retro bikes. You immediately forget that underneath the pretty dress is the normal Z650, because thanks to the right details, the retro design has been convincingly implemented. In the saddle, you enjoy the accessibility that you know from the technical sister. A retro bike that both beginners and experienced bikers will really enjoy!
